A proposed ordinance banning parking on Orchard Park Drive (Summary No. 1536-OR) failed for lack of majority support after residents urged council not to defer the item and raised concerns about scope and timing.

The St. Martin Parish Council on Feb. 3 considered but ultimately failed to adopt an ordinance that would have prohibited parking on Orchard Park Drive.
